3D modeling is a computer graphic technique to create a 3D digital representation of any object or surface. To create a 3D model, you can use special software like Blender, Tinkercad or Maya to manipulate the vertices (points in virtual space) that create a mesh. This group of vertices in a mesh form a 3D object.

The fundamental base of 3D models are the mesh that can be modified to create any form you want. This process allows you to create digital objects that can be fully animated. This makes this technique an essential tool to develop characters, animations and special effects.

What is 3D modeling used for?

Since you can create almost anything with 3D models, they can be used for a great variety of applications. You will find 3D models in video games, movies, robotics, architecture, illustration, engineering, advertising, fashion, medicine and more!

Therefore, 3D modeling has become an essential skill of many creative and technological careers. For example, game designers, animators and developers can bring their ideas to life using the power of 3D models. Architects and engineers use it to plan, design and preview the details of their work. And almost every Hollywood movie creates their amazing special effects using 3D models and animation.
